WitrynaTransitive verbs can be classified by the number of objects they require. Verbs that accept only two arguments, a subject and a single direct object, are monotransitive. Verbs that accept two objects, a direct object and an indirect object, are ditransitive, [2] or less commonly bitransitive. WitrynaWhen the verb has an object that receives the direct action of the verb, it is called a transitive verb. Mostly, a transitive verb takes a single object. However, sometimes it takes two objects – one indirect and one direct object. Study the Introduction to Verbs here. A direct object is the receiver of the action done by the verb in the sentence. Witryna24 lut 2024 · The prepositional verb is considered intransitive as it cannot take an object itself: The art critic looked at the painting. (correct) *The art critic looked the painting. (incorrect) His parents have been arguing about money. (correct) *His parents have been arguing money. (incorrect) His parents have been arguing. Witryna18 kwi 2012 · When a verb is transitive it always has an object. It is incorrect to use a transitive verb without an object. The object of a transitive verb can be: a noun Tom sold his house. They drank the beer. a pronoun He sold it. He kissed her. Transitive verbs with two objects Some transitive verbs, such as ‘lend’, ‘give’ and ‘buy’ can …
